About this experience

Remote & Off-the-Beaten-Path Guests leave the crowds behind and explore a part of the Red Sea desert that few travelers ever see. It’s truly secluded, peaceful, and untouched. Dramatic Desert Landscapes Hike past rugged rock formations, panoramic views of Black and Red Egla peaks, and sudden lush valleys. The contrast of desert and greenery is rare and photogenic. Authentic Local Insights Your expert guide shares knowledge about desert plants, hidden wildlife, ancient trade routes, and Bedouin traditions along the way — not just scenery. Surprise Green Oasis Descending into Wadi El Waha, the desert transforms into a lush, unexpected valley. Few treks in the area offer this hidden greenery. Tea by the Fire in the Desert End the hike with a traditional tea ritual — an intimate, memorable way to soak in the solitude and landscape..
